International Baptist College and Seminary vs University of Phoenix-Arizona

International Baptist College and Seminary is a private college in Chandler, AZ. University of Phoenix-Arizona is a private for-profit university in Phoenix, AZ. Both admit about 100% of applicants. Students pay an average of about $13,520 a year at University of Phoenix-Arizona after aid, and about $14,660 at International Baptist College and Seminary. Ten years after enrolling, International Baptist College and Seminary alumni earn a median of about $39,556, against $37,752 for University of Phoenix-Arizona.

What is the full cost of attendance at International Baptist College and Seminary and University of Phoenix-Arizona?
Before aid, University of Phoenix-Arizona costs about $19,909 a year and International Baptist College and Seminary about $29,112.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.

Which is bigger, International Baptist College and Seminary or University of Phoenix-Arizona?
University of Phoenix-Arizona is the larger of the two, with about 85,991 undergraduates against 43 at International Baptist College and Seminary.
Do graduates of International Baptist College and Seminary or University of Phoenix-Arizona earn more?
International Baptist College and Seminary alumni earn more on average: a median of about $39,556 ten years after enrolling, against about $37,752 for University of Phoenix-Arizona.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
